Stacy Fetyko Obituary

Stacy Lynn (Tuite) Fetyko

AGE: 38 • Brick

Stacy Lynn (Tuite) Fetyko, age 38, of Brick, passed away on Saturday, May 7, 2011 at home. Born in Point Pleasant, she lived in Brick most of her life. She was a member of St. Dominic's RC Church, Brick.

She is survived by her husband, James Fetyko; her parents Edward J. and Dolores (Di Donato) Tuite of Brick; four children Matthew, Daniel, Amanda and Cynthia; two brothers Edward J. Tuite Jr. of Bath, NY and Michael J. Tuite of Nutley, NJ; and her mother and father in law John and Charlotte Fetyko of Lakewood.

Visiting hours are Tuesday 4-8 pm at Colonial Funeral Home, 2170 Highway 88, Brick. A Mass of Christian Burial will be offered on Wednesday at 9 am at St. Dominic's Church, Brick, followed by interment at St. Mary of the Lake Cemetery, Lakewood.
